ORDER

This Civil Revision petition arises out of the order passed by the learned Subordinate Judge, Ambasamudram, in E.P.No.15 of 2016 in O.S.No.20 of 2007, dated 22.10.2016.

2. Heard the learned counsel appearing for the petitioners.

3. According to the petitioners, the respondent herein filed an application in E.P.No.15 of 2016 before the Court below, under Order 21 Rule 34 of C.P.C., to execute the sale deed in terms of the decree passed by the Court below, dated 08.12.2015. Against the Judgment and Decree passed by the Court below in O.S.No.20 of 2007, the petitioners had preferred an appeal along with I.A.No.198 of 2016 to condone the delay in filing the appeal before the Court below and the same is pending. In the meantime, the Court below has passed an order dated 22.10.2016, allowing the Execution petition in E.P.No.15 of 2016 in O.S.No.20 of 2007. Against the said order, the petitioners have filed the present Revision petition before this Court.

4. Against the Judgment and Decree in the aforesaid suit, the petitioners had filed an appeal along with a petition to condone the delay in filing the appeal. The said interlocutory application was numbered as I.A.No.198 of 2016 and notice has been ordered and the same is pending before the Court below. In such circumstances, the petitioners have filed the present Revision against the order passed by the Court below in Execution petition. Hence, the present Civil Revision petition cannot be entertained.

5. Hence, this Civil Revision petition is dismissed. However, this Court direct the learned Subordinate Judge, Ambasamudram, to consider the application in I.A.No.198 of 2016 as expeditiously as possible.

No costs. Consequently, connected Miscellaneous petition is closed.
